Before diving into the impacts of lot size consistency, it’s important first to establish what it means. A 'lot' in trading parlance refers to the bundle of units involved in a trade. The consistency of this size refers to maintaining a standard or stable number of units across various trades. This consistency is vital in managing risks and maintaining trading discipline, especially in prop trading, where traders use proprietary funds from a company.
